sventoepke.de

Ich erschaffe das, was Sie sich vorstellen

WordPress – Android und anderen Dateien das Hochladen erlauben

Wer artfremde Dateien in WordPress hochladen will, um sie anderen Nutzern zu Verfügung zu stellen, bekommt höchstwahrscheinlich die Meldung „Tut mir leid, aber aus Sicherheitsgründen ist dieser Dateityp nicht erlaubt.“ angezeigt. So ist es mir beim Einstellen der ersten AndroidApp auf dieser Seite passiert.

Um dies abzustellen müssen wir uns auf den Weg machen und die „functions.php“ suchen. Diese liegt im Ordner „/wp-includes“. Innerhalb der „functions.php“ gibt es eine Funktion namens „get_allowed_mime_types()“ die alle Datentypen inklusive ihres MIME-Types beinhaltet, die WordPress problemlos hochladen lässt. Dort greifen wir ein und schreiben am Ende dieser Liste im Falle einer AndroidApp folgendes.

‘apk’ => ‘application/vnd.android.package-archive’,

Zuletzt speichert Ihr die veränderte „functions.php“ und lädt sie wieder hoch. Nun könnt auch Ihr AndroidApps anbieten.

Dies ist jedoch nicht auf Android Applikationen beschränkt, sondern lässt sich mit jedem Dateitypen bewerkstelligen. Hier noch ein Beispiel für die Einbindung von RAR Archiven.

‘rar’ => ‘application/x-rar-compressed’,